Hi all,

Quick heads-up from the front desk: the shuttle-bus gate on the Corbel Street side is now staffed only until 6pm. After that, drivers will buzz reception directly, so keep an ear on the intercom. If the gate arm sticks (it does, often), you can release it manually with the pass code below.

Thanks!
Front Desk, Almery Park

turnstile pass: bdg-YPPQB-52010

## Break-Glass Access — Pylonmetrics Sidecar

External plugin authors normally interact with the Pylonmetrics aggregation sidecar through the scoped plugin API. If the sidecar's admin socket becomes unreachable and your plugin cannot flush buffered metrics, break-glass access applies. This bypasses the Fennwick gateway and writes directly to the aggregator spool. Use it only when the status page shows a spool stall. Unlock the break-glass console with the recovery passphrase printed below.

recovery phrase for kagup-kawif: zorael-holael

Welcome to the Brightfall design systems team. Each quarter we run a color-contrast accessibility audit across the Lanternview dashboard and the Pebblework admin console. New team members are expected to review the current audit checklist before their first sprint, learn how we record contrast ratios in the Huemark tracker, and flag any component below WCAG AA thresholds. If you have questions about the audit process or tooling access, reach out to the audit coordinator.

escalation mailbox, kadup-fajof: ulador@qirvanlabs.corp